Use str for text inputs. Renders as a single-line text input by default.
from func_to_web import run
def basic(name: str):
return f"Hello, {name}!"
run(basic)from func_to_web import run
def defaults(name: str = "World"):
return f"Hello, {name}!"
run(defaults)from typing import Annotated
from pydantic import Field
from func_to_web import run
def constraints(
username: Annotated[str, Field(min_length=3, max_length=20)],
password: Annotated[str, Field(min_length=8)],
phone: Annotated[str, Field(pattern=r'^\+?[0-9]{10,15}$')],
bio: Annotated[str, Field(max_length=500)] = "Hello!",
):
return f"User: {username}"
run(constraints)| Constraint | Meaning |
|---|---|
min_length |
Minimum number of characters |
max_length |
Maximum number of characters |
pattern |
Regex pattern the value must match |
from typing import Annotated
from func_to_web import run
from func_to_web.types import Placeholder
def placeholder(name: Annotated[str, Placeholder("e.g. John Doe")]):
return f"Hello, {name}!"
run(placeholder)Customize the error message shown when the pattern constraint fails:
